St. Peter School
Diocese of Springfield in Illinois
St. Peter School is a highly-regarded Catholic school located just 4 miles from Menard in Petersburg. Serving students from Pre-K through 8th grade, the school offers a comprehensive academic program rooted in Catholic values. The school features small class sizes, dedicated faculty, and modern facilities including technology-integrated classrooms. Extracurricular programs include basketball, volleyball, chess club, and various academic competitions. The school maintains strong community ties and has served central Illinois families for generations with a focus on academic excellence and character development.

Sacred Heart-Griffin High School
Diocese of Springfield in Illinois
Sacred Heart-Griffin is a premier Catholic college preparatory high school located approximately 20 miles from Menard in Springfield. The school offers a rigorous academic curriculum with numerous Advanced Placement courses and a comprehensive STEM program. Facilities include state-of-the-art science labs, performing arts center, and extensive athletic facilities. SHG boasts a 99% college acceptance rate and offers over 40 clubs and activities. The school emphasizes faith formation, academic excellence, and service learning, making it a top choice for families throughout central Illinois.

The Springfield Montessori School
American Montessori Society
The Springfield Montessori School is an accredited Montessori institution serving children from toddler through elementary ages. Located approximately 18 miles from Menard in Springfield, the school offers an individualized learning approach that fosters independence and critical thinking. The campus features beautifully prepared Montessori classrooms, extensive outdoor learning environments, and specialized materials for hands-on learning. The school maintains low student-teacher ratios and emphasizes holistic development. With a strong focus on community and individualized pacing, it provides an exceptional alternative to traditional education models in the central Illinois region.
